Number of Poles for Induction Motor 1
Default: 4
Settings 2–64
Sets the number poles for the motor (must be an even number).
Set up Pr. 01-01 and Pr. 05-03 before setting up Pr. 05-04 to make sure the motor operates
normally. Pr. 01-01 and Pr. 05-03 determine the maximum set up number poles for the IM.
For example: Pr. 01-01 = 20 Hz and Pr. 05-03 = 39 rpm, according to the equation 120 x 20Hz /
39rpm = 61.5 and take even number, the number of poles is 60. Therefore, Pr. 05-04 can be set
to the maximum of 60 poles.

Full-load Current for Induction Motor 2 (A)
Default: Depending
on the model power
Settings Depending on the model power
Set this value according to the rated current of the motor as indicated on the motor nameplate.
The default 90% of the drive’s rated current.
Example: The rated current for a 7.5 HP (5.5 kW) motor is 25 A. The default is 22.5 A.
The setting range is between 40 %–120 % of rated current.
25 * 40 % = 10 A and 25 * 120 % = 30 A
